I need to remove the glove box lining to get to wires behind the dash. On removing the horn press I was confronted with this, and not the nut to remove the steering wheel?
Any hints as to what has happened please?

I can see the photo ok. All you have done is remove the 'M' centre badge from the hornpush and not the full hornpush itself. You need to remove the full circular black bakelite(?) and that removes the hornpush and everything. If you look on the centre column behind the hornpush, there is a screw which needs to be removed and the whole assembly comes off.
